Cummins Engine and Caterpillar, Various Companies, Different Methods

Confronted with difficult North American environmental polices for weighty truck engines, companies who created engines experienced to create some tough selections: Caterpillar decided to exit the industry, when Cummins decided to continue to be. How can two businesses look at the similar external setting and think of entirely diverse techniques?

Caterpillar's strengths lie in hefty machines enhancement and production for building, agriculture along with other marketplaces; their skills didn't lie specially in motor progress
Cummins' strengths lie in engine enhancement and generation
The main element takeaway: Good technique is based on recognizing a industry prospect and possessing the talents to benefit from it. Caterpillar felt that their ability-set did not match the requirements for designing engines to fulfill the reduced emissions standards and that their resources can be better focused on building devices for unique apps for development. Cummins, nonetheless, strictly centered on engines, believed that their talent-established built them uniquely capable to capitalize to the more and more regulated ecosystem. Equally firms might be proper - very good approaches are based upon deciding on marketplaces that value your special competencies. Cummins' competencies close to hefty truck engines allowed it to significantly enhance industry share when Caterpillar remaining the large truck motor marketplace.

How Cummins Chose this Method?

Rising marketplaces tend to be criticized for with the ability to compete on lessen expenses, because of a fewer stringent regulatory atmosphere. As these markets create, they not just see the economic great things about industrialization, but will also see the expense, generally enhanced pollution. But as air pollution results in being unbearable, nations are adopting more and more strict environmental regulations. Will these regulations Keep to the regulatory criteria which have been established in North The united states? Obviously not, that will be way too effortless! Rising trends include things like:

Enhanced industrialization
Enhanced air pollution
Increased rules (but different for every area)
Major truck suppliers located in these regions had to make your mind up:

Must we develop the engineering to fulfill the regulations?
Should really we buy the technologies and give attention to output as demand proceeds to improve?
For several heavy truck companies, the second alternative was a lot more attractive as the essential talent-established demanded for more eco-friendly engines wasn't something which the manufacturers excelled at. Why not outsource the motor design and style?

Cummins noticed these traits and assessed approaches to fulfill the demand - one way they could have fulfilled the need was by furnishing only the North American technological know-how. However, Cummins had the foresight to know that with the different laws, distinctive solutions could well be greatest for every area. So instead of proceed with "one dimensions suits all," they selected to pursue a "fit-for-sector" solution. The regional truck makers embraced the Cummins strategy simply because this intended that they'd not have to alter their truck structure in an effort to in shape the Cummins motor demands. In its place, Cummins would structure an engine to satisfy their area's environmental necessities. Their competitors had been chagrined at this tactic, as that they had taken the "a person sizing fits all" technique which system slowed their engines' acceptance in emerging marketplaces.
